Here's our new lettering! I hope Randy likes it. I had to choose it in his absense. Letras Alfarro did the work. He's from Panama City. He did a good job but it took him a month and a half from the time he showed me his samples to the day he showed up with the letters. Thank goodness I didn't pay him in advance.

We have decided to transit the Panama Canal again (North to South, Caribbean to Pacific) on March 24, 2010. Stanley is our agent again. He's very jolly these days as he has much more business during the "dry" season. Our neighbours who use Stanley, Woolloobooloo (Simon) got delayed in their transit. They are hoping to get through tomorrow.

Cristobal Marine said they were going to inspect the vacu-flush heads today but I have not seen them around. There is no "vacu" and hence no "flush". It's always something.

Panchita (Ted and Joan) are back early from the San Blas due to the fact that their refrigeration quit. Equinox (Hank and Betsy are coming in tomorrow with autopilot problems. It'll be nice to have some old friends around. We met Panchit and Equinox back in Huatulco last February. We all set out to cross the Tehaunapec together.

Our plans after the canal transit are to visit the Las Perlas Islands, Panama and then take Lost Elvis back to Paradise Village in Nuevo Vallarta, Mexico. We will commute, as little as possible, from Mexico while we make money for our next trip to the South Pacific in March 2010. But you never know, one of Randy's nicknames is, after all, "Random".
